Mini diamond anvils for X-ray Raman scattering spectroscopy HP experiments |
Almax easyLab supplies a lot of miniature Boehler-Almax diamond anvils for this inelastic scattering method that uses hard X-rays of the order of 10 keV to measure energy-loss spectra at absorption edges of light elements (Si, Mg, O etc.) with an energy resolution below 1 eV. These conical diamonds have diameters down to 1.00 mm and thicknesses down to 0.50 mm which allow pressure generation up to 70 GPa often – but not exclusively - in conjunction with PCD diamond seats (only 1 size available: diameter 13.65 mm and thickness of 4.00 mm). This set-up significantly enhances the signal-to-noise ratio of this XRS technique.

Mini diamond anvils for dynamic HP experiments |
Almax easyLab supplies a lot of premounted mini Boehler-Almax diamond anvils and windows for dynamic shock wave high pressure. These conical diamonds have diameters down to 1.25 mm and thicknesses down to 0.25 mm.

Maxi synthetic CVD diamond anvils for neutron HP experiments |
Almax easyLab is supplying some very large diamond anvils polished from synthetic type IIa CVD diamond. Diameters up to 10.00 mm and thickness up to 5.00 mm are available these days. The material is clean from any inclusions or cracks, but there is still some evenly distributed birefringence present.
